Vantaggi

Good benefits and 401k. Power route bonus's were decent.

Svantaggi

60+ hours a week and salaried for $600 a week. Didn't get paid quarterly bonus's like we were suppose to. Upper management does NOT care about the route drivers, even though we are the "face" and "backbone" of the company. We would get told we're working to many hours, then have more work and more stops added to our route. Hard work and dedication are not rewarded at this location, or by this GM.

Vantaggi

Upper management genuinely cares about their team, and the hiring process is simple and straightforward. Base pay and the monthly stipend are both fair, and I appreciate the company's structure — questions get answered quickly, and you have dedicated team member support. I also like that the role is self-managing, with CDR handling pricing and deal structuring so you can focus on your own performance. Overall, this company really takes care of its employees.

Svantaggi

The pay structure for this role is a bit unique — after a sale closes, the CDR earns commission for the first few months, and then commission transitions over to the drive team. It's certainly not a deal-breaker, just an observation, and I'm not knocking the company for it. All in all, I had a wonderful experience at UniFirst.
